I think what folks are trying to say is that the SQL stuff is separate to the struts stuff, and this is kind of what its about. There is a data source definition that confuses the hell out of people new to struts as it seems to implicitly suggest that it should be used.
However most of the folks advise against its use as it encourages breaking with MVC.. That said, there are examples in the documentation and if you're used to quick dirty SQL in html pages then using struts even when breaking MVC is still progress.
You'll want some JDBC references and google will find you some.
when you've got the hang of doing SQL (JDBC) stuff in your struts flavored webapp. I really dont know why folks get so snobby about people breaking with MVC to get started.. The funny thing is its the same folks recommending JSTL which have SQL as part of the lib.
When you've done all that and you've seen what a pain it can be, you'll naturally arrive at the point where you'll hate SQL and be gagging for an object-relational bridge. But I'd worry about this when you get here..
